Semantic analysis: definition and uses

Semantic analysis is the essential foundation of a SEO audit successful. It transforms your web content to maximize its visibility on search engines. At the heart of natural referencing, this strategic approach decodes the intentions of users in order to respond to them accurately. A semantically optimized site doesn't just rank higher — it offers a superior user experience. Ready to propel your content strategy at the top? Learn how to master semantic analysis to dominate your niche.

Dig deeper with AI:
Claude
Perplexity
GPT chat

What to remember about semantic analysis

  • Basis of the SEO strategy : Semantic analysis is not a simple option but the essential basis for any effective SEO, establishing the link between your content and the search intentions of users.
  • Dual lens : Beyond optimizing your visibility on search engines, semantic analysis aims to improve the user experience by offering relevant content that precisely answers your audience's questions.
  • Methodical process : Successful semantic analysis follows a structured approach - identification of purchase intent, in-depth study of keywords, analysis of positioning and strategic organization of content.
  • Structure and hierarchy : Organizing your content into semantic cocoons and setting up a coherent tree structure are essential to strengthen the thematic authority of your site.
  • Ongoing approach : Semantic analysis is not a one-time action but a continuous improvement process that must adapt to changes in the language of your audience and search engine algorithms.

What is semantic analysis?

Semantic analysis: definition & challenges

THEEditorial SEO audit, also known under the term”semantic audit” or “semantic analysis”, which is an integral part of a SEO audit, aims to assess the coherence and relevance of the content of a website. It is a methodical process that revolves around several axes and is implemented during the origination Or the redesign of a site internet.

The challenges of this analysis are multiple. It is not only about improving the visibility of the site on search engines, but also to offer a better experience to Internet users and to convert your prospects into customers more effectively.

In addition to this approach, semantic SEO audit is often associated withSEO technical audit, forming a global approach that assesses both the quality of the content and the technical solidity of the site. This correlation is essential, as it ensures a coherent and effective SEO strategy.

Editorial or semantic audit?

Editorial auditing and the concept of semantic auditing both evaluate web content in order to optimize it, but from different perspectives:

- The editorial audit looks at the overall quality of the content, analyzing both content and form, for the entire site or specific pages.

- The semantic audit, on the other hand, looks at keywords and content from an SEO perspective, focusing on the relevance of the terms used.

While they aim to improve content, their approach and goals differ. This is why it often happens that some company or agency does not solve the entire semantic problem when it starts the semantic audit of their website.

What do you need to know about semantic analysis?

Semantic analysis for a website: How does it work?

THEsemantic analysis In SEO is based on a thorough understanding of the meaning of words and expressions in a specific context. It is based on the semantics, which studies the meaning of words and sentences.

To understand how semantic analysis works, it is essential to understand how search engines interpret the content of a web page. The latter use semantic analysis algorithms, constantly updated, to understand and interpret the meaning and relevance of a text.

Google works like a response engine : it seeks to understand the intent behind each request in order to provide the most relevant and accurate response possible. Its objective is no longer just to provide a list of relevant pages, but to improve the meaning of words and to understand the user's query to give them the information they are looking for directly. This is a major change in the way search engines work.

The importance of semantic analysis

Semantic analysis is a fundamental component of the digital landscape, significantly influencing various aspects ranging from customer relationships to SEO strategy.

  • First, it is essential for understanding consumer intentions, thus improvingcustomer experience.
  • It optimizes theUX by structuring web content to facilitate navigation and understanding.
  • In terms of productivity, it guides content creation by identifying relevant topics and keywords from data (thanks to SEO KPI for example).
  • For the SEO, it improves natural referencing in real time by aligning content with users' search intentions.

What tools for semantic analysis (free and paid)?

Keyword generators

  • Ubbersuggest is a free tool that allows you to identify keyword ideas adapted to your field. It also offers domain analysis and site audits.
  • SEMrush is a more comprehensive tool that includes more than 50 SEO tools. In particular, it is used for competitive analysis and the study of research intentions.
  • Yooda offers a suite of tools for semantic analysis, including Insight, which is particularly used for market analysis in the context of marketing research.

To “crawl” your site

Crawling tools like Screaming Frog and Xenu are essential for carrying out a thorough semantic analysis.

  • Screaming Frog, collects data essential for SEO optimization, such as site structure, meta tags, incoming and outgoing links... It also allows the identification of HTTP errors, indexing problems or broken links.
  • Xenu, while offering fewer features than Screaming Frog, Xenu is an excellent choice for quick and effective link analysis, including the detection of broken or erroneous links.

For the monitoring of positions

These three tools can be used to track your site's positions in search results, and to understand how your content is performing on various keywords.

  • Google Analytics is a free tool that allows you to track and analyze the traffic on your website. It provides valuable information about user behavior, such as time spent on the site, bounce rate, and the most visited pages.
  • Matomo is an open-source web analysis platform. It offers a private alternative to Google Analytics that focuses on data privacy.
  • MyPoseo is another option for tracking SEO positions. It offers market analysis, audit, and SEO/SEA monitoring, making it a comprehensive tool for SEO professionals.

For the structure of the pages

To structure your pages and optimize their SEO, chrome extensions Web Developer and SEO in One Click are proving to be valuable tools.

  • Web Developer allows you to analyze and manipulate the architecture of your site. It is a great ally to identify and correct structural errors that could harm your SEO.
  • SEO in One Click offers an instant analysis of the SEO of your page. It provides you with information about meta tags, links, images, and much more.

For content quality analysis

  • With Site Liner, you can perform an in-depth analysis of the content of your site to identify duplicates and weaknesses in your content.
  • Ahref, on the other hand, is a more complete tool that allows you not only to analyze your content, but also to monitor your backlink profile, study your competitors and discover new keywords to target.
  • The advantage of SEobility is an SEO tool that analyzes an entire website, identifying errors and problems that could affect your SEO.
SEO Semantic Analysis Tools
SEO Semantic Analysis Tools

What are the steps of semantic analysis?

Step 1: Identify the purchase intent of the target customer

To enter and define theIntent to buy of our target audience, it is essential to start by laying the foundations of our offer. This involves asking questions such as:

  • What products or services do we offer?
  • How are our offers positioned in relation to those of competitors?
  • How do we differentiate ourselves?
  • What is our market positioning strategy?

These initial reflections make it possible to identify the stakes Majors and the issues specific to our client target, and thus to better understand the audience segments we reach in the face of their problems.

By doing so, we can better understand the precise expectations of our customers and what they are looking for when choosing our offers. Managing customer journeys on our site is essential to adjust our strategies, thus responding directly to the requests of our potential prospects. This improves their experience by aligning our services with their expectations.

Once you have a good understanding of the purchase intent of your target customer, you are in a position to create the best customer journeys and add the right content.

The types of research intentions
The types of research intentions

Step 2: Study the keywords

The study of keywords: How do we go about it?

THEkeyword study is THE major step in semantic analysis. It allows you to identify the terms that your target audience uses during his research, which is essential for understanding their behavior and expectations.

To do this, you need to use keyword analysis tools to discover relevant terms in your sector.

  • What search phrases will my target customer type to get to my site?
  • What are the most frequently asked questions about my website?

We seek to answer these questions, based on our customer target and on the semantic field of our competitors.

Once the keywords have been identified, they must be integrated strategically into the content of your site to improve your positioning on search engines.

Selecting relevant keywords

The selection of relevant keywords is a major challenge in semantic audit to target those essential to your audience and activity.

A distinction must be made between specific keywords, which can be long lines, which are precise and indicate a clear intention, from generic, broader and competitive keywords.

Use tools like Google Keyword Planner or SEMrush to analyze search volume, competition, and keyword relevance. Integrate them naturally into your content to boost SEO without over-optimization.

Step 3: Analyze the positioning

Study of positioning in general: For what purpose?

THEpositioning study The objective of general is to assess the place occupied by your website in relation to its competitors and in its digital environment. This step allows you to understand what factors influence your positioning, whether it is the keywords used, the content offered or the structure of your pages.

The positioning study includes several aspects:

  • the positioning of the pages on the site
  • the positioning of the site in relation to its competitors
  • The analysis of the SERP (Search Engine Results Page)

To assess the positioning of pages, we examine their visibility on search engines, their traffic and their conversion rate. Their content, structure and SEO optimization are also studied.

Competition analysis consists in identifying the site's main competitors and comparing their positioning with ours. In particular, we look at their SEO strategies, their target keywords and their traffic.

SERP analysis makes it possible to measure the visibility of the site on search engines. It is based on several criteria, including the number of pages indexed, the number of backlinks, the click through rate (CTR) and the time spent on the site.

Positioning study based on keywords

The positioning study according to keywords is carried out with the help of analytical tools such as Sistrix or SEMrush. These tools make it possible to determine which keywords the site is well positioned on, but also which keywords generate the most organic traffic.

It is also important to distinguish between the different types of keywords:

  • Notoriety keywords, which are linked to the brand or company name.
  • The keywords of partners or associated brands, which can bring qualified traffic.
  • Keywords relating to the products or services offered by the site.
  • And finally, keywords related to editorial content, such as blog posts or technical data sheets.

Analyzing the positioning of the site on these different types of keywords makes it possible to understand what are the strengths and areas for improvement of the SEO strategy.

Step 4: Categorize content and keywords

Tree structure, queries, and semantic cocoon

THETree, the requests and the semantic cocoon are key elements in the establishment of a marketing strategy effective.

  • THETree of your site must be designed in such a way as to promote SEO. It must be clear and logical, focusing on the most important pages, and not forgetting any customer journey.
  • Les requisitions, they are defined according to the keywords identified during the semantic analysis, during your keyword study and your positioning analysis. It's about understanding how your target audience is looking for your products or services and adapting your content accordingly.
  • Finally, the semantic cocoon, also called silo, is a content organization technique that aims to strengthen the authority of your site on certain topics. It is about creating groups of pages around the same theme, linked together, to improve their referencing. This practice is used in the design of a blog, in order to enhance quality content on your site, in order to improve your overall positioning.

These three elements, combined, make it possible to optimize your positioning on search engines.

Densify its content

Content densification is key for SEO, aimed at enriching existing content to better meet search engine criteria.

Start by crawling your pages to detect those with low content, which will benefit from densification.

Next, develop a content strategy aligned with your domain, including creating semantic cocoons and regularly writing relevant articles to generate traffic.

Prioritize the creation of content that meets the search intentions of your audience, by providing accurate and useful answers.

The quality and relevance of content are essential to improve both SEO and the user experience.

Summary of semantic analysis steps
Summary of semantic analysis steps

Successfully complete your semantic audit

Analyzing your existing system: the editorial structure

Optimizing meta data

The optimization of meta data : It involves refining the elements that are not visible on a website, but which have a major impact on its referencing by search engines.

Les meta title and meta description should be carefully written to reflect the content of the page and contain relevant keywords. They need to be unique and attractive. They must respect a maximum of 60 and 150 characters respectively.

La ALT tag plays an important role for the referencing of images, but also for the accessibility of the website. Each image must therefore have a relevant and descriptive ALT tag of 3 to 5 words maximum.

Optimizing the structure of the site

THEoptimizing the structure of the site is a fundamental step for good referencing.

Les URLs should be clear and contain relevant keywords. They should also be consistent with the structure of your site and not be too deep.

La page structuring implies a logical organization of content. The Hn structure with the H1, H2, etc. tags allows you to structure your texts and help search engines understand the content of your pages.

The internal networking, A practice that is very commonly omitted, allows you to create links between the different pages of your site. It makes it easy for the user to navigate and helps search engines index your site. To do this, be sure to create relevant links between your pages and promote links to the most important pages.

Internal linking
Internal linking

Semantic analysis is important for improving your site's SEO, aligning content with user intent to optimize the user experience. A relevant keyword strategy, a well-thought-out site structure, and quality content are key to SEO. In other words, semantic analysis allows you to create content that specifically answers the questions and needs of your target audience, while applying the key principles of SEO to optimize their visibility on the web.

Semantic analysis: what recommendations?

Why semantic analysis for a site?

Semantic analysis is essential for several reasons. First, it allows you to understand the information architecture of your site, thus offering a better user experience. Second, it helps identify relevant keywords and queries that can improve your SEO ranking. Thirdly, it facilitates the identification of content gaps, thus providing an opportunity to produce quality and relevant content to meet the specific demands of Internet users. Finally, it makes it possible to stand out in an increasingly competitive digital environment by offering unique and quality content.

How to do a semantic analysis (in SEO)?

For effective semantic analysis in SEO, start by understanding your sector and audience to select suitable keywords. Use tools like Sistrix or SEMrush to identify relevant terms. Integrate these keywords into quality content that meets the expectations of your audience. Also optimize the structure of your pages, meta tags and internal networking to boost your positioning in search results.

What is the definition of semantics?

Semantics, a branch of linguistics, studies the meaning of words, sentences, and their arrangement in language, including literal and implicit meanings. She looks at how meaning is constructed and communicated, emphasizing the role of context in interpretation. In addition, semantics are crucial in natural language processing (NLP) to help computers understand natural language.

👋 Was this content useful to you?

At Sales Odyssey, we like to dig deep into topics, test, refine, and share what works.

We help you with:
Audits that snap

We audit and analyze your site, your competitors, your strategic keywords.

Effective SEO & GEO strategies

We build a tailor-made SEO & GEO strategy, aligned with your business challenges.

Content that sends

We produce and optimize content that speaks to your customers as well as to engines.

👉 50+ accelerated customers in 2024.
What if we talked about it?